Check Digit Verification of cas no

The CAS Registry Mumber 207675-84-1 includes 9 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 6 digits, 2,0,7,6,7 and 5 respectively; the second part has 2 digits, 8 and 4 respectively.
Calculate Digit Verification of CAS Registry Number 207675-84:
(8*2)+(7*0)+(6*7)+(5*6)+(4*7)+(3*5)+(2*8)+(1*4)=151
151 % 10 = 1
So 207675-84-1 is a valid CAS Registry Number.

Discovery of Ruzasvir (MK-8408): A Potent, Pan-Genotype HCV NS5A Inhibitor with Optimized Activity against Common Resistance-Associated Polymorphisms

Tong, Ling,Yu, Wensheng,Chen, Lei,Selyutin, Oleg,Dwyer, Michael P.,Nair, Anilkumar G.,Mazzola, Robert,Kim, Jae-Hun,Sha, Deyou,Yin, Jingjun,Ruck, Rebecca T.,Davies, Ian W.,Hu, Bin,Zhong, Bin,Hao, Jinglai,Ji, Tao,Zan, Shuai,Liu, Rong,Agrawal, Sony,Xia, Ellen,Curry, Stephanie,McMonagle, Patricia,Bystol, Karin,Lahser, Frederick,Carr, Donna,Rokosz, Laura,Ingravallo, Paul,Chen, Shiying,Feng, Kung-I,Cartwright, Mark,Asante-Appiah, Ernest,Kozlowski, Joseph A.

, p. 290 - 306 (2017)

We describe the research that led to the discovery of compound 40 (ruzasvir, MK-8408), a pan-genotypic HCV nonstructural protein 5A (NS5A) inhibitor with a "flat" GT1 mutant profile. This NS5A inhibitor contains a unique tetracyclic indole core while maintaining the imidazole-proline-valine Moc motifs of our previous NS5A inhibitors. Compound 40 is currently in early clinical trials and is under evaluation as part of an all-oral DAA regimen for the treatment of chronic HCV infection.
